Transaction 8d3443cd00615a055ee7a528caf939c428464de03fda3d23b383e153819455c8
1 Input
1 Output
-
8d3443cd00615a055ee7a528caf939c428464de03fda3d23b383e153819455c8:0
- value
- 2517896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e55c5883da235fc759cfc3406f1ea5b733ba3230 OP_EQUAL
- address
- 3NbmHmYyWCs9oePzjm8S3HfVbgnCXFw6DH